nGuard CSIR

The nGuard CSIR service supplies your firm with an expert Cyber Security Incident Response Team

Description

nGuard CSIR is available in two forms:
  • CSIR Complete: For pro-active organizations that recognize the strategic & compliance benefit of having a CSIR capability in place at all times, nGuard’s CSIR Complete is the best option. CSIR Complete provides a full CSIR program with guaranteed service-level commitments, priority response, and ongoing proactive activities throughout the year.

Features: Priority Response Our cybersecurity incident response team is ready to help with an unexpected security event when you need us most. Guaranteed response times ensure you’re not tackling a security breach on your own. Bundled Response Services There’s no time to worry about quotes, approval processes, or signatures when you’re trying to respond to a cybersecurity incident. nGuard’s standard CSIR services come with several days of remote, expert, incident response assistance. Customers also have the option of including onsite response services, as well. Secure Communications In the event of a breach, private conversations between all responding individuals is crucial. nGuard’s CSIR service includes full access to the nGuard Client Portal (NCP) for encrypted, out-of-band, email communication via MessageSafe. Secure Offsite File Storage Maintaining the integrity of incident-related files is key to the response and possible forensics investigation. Another key feature of nGuard’s Client Portal (NCP) is FileSafe, which provides a secure, offsite, location to store critical data outside the reach of the potential hacker. Best-in-Class Expertise At nGuard, our incident response security professionals come from a wide range of IT backgrounds and hold various security certifications including CISSP, GSNA, OSCP, GIAC Certifications, Certified Ethical Hacker (C|EH), Security+ and more. Semi-Annual Program Reviews In-depth, semi-annual reviews provide the insight you need to gauge the state of security within your organization. A summary report of the prior 6 months provides an overview of previous security incidents and/or breaches, discussion of trending incidents, upcoming changes to the environment, etc.
